This year South Korea will celebrate the Lunar New Year’s Day, or ‘Seol-Nal,’ on January 22. Seol-Nal is a traditional Korean holiday. Many Koreans travel to their family’s home for the celebration. Charye, where food is set on a table as an offering to one’s ancestors, is done. Tteok-guk or rice cake soup is served. […]
